Population & Demographics

The following information lists the population statistics and breakdown for the 08324 zip code. The total population is 308, of which, 141 are male and 167 are female. With a total area of 21.984 square miles, the population density is 12.6 people per square mile. The median age of the population is 27.7 years old. Income & Economic Characteristics

The median inflation-adjusted family income in the 08324 zip code is $61875. This is 16.33% greater than the national average. This income places 2.6% of the population below the poverty line. The average retirement income for individuals in this zip code (for those that have it) is $29252. Education

In the 08324 zip code, 72.7% of individuals over 25 years old have a high school degree or higher, and 18.2% have a bachelors degree or higher. Additionally, 0% of individuals 3 years and older are in private school, and 100% are in public school. The data below outline the education level breakdown, degree field breakdown, and more.




Occupation and Work Characteristics

In the 08324 zip, there are an estimated 105 people in the labor force, of which, 105 are employed, and 0 are unemployed. There are a total of 0 people in the armed forces. The average commute time for this zip code is 41.7 minutes. Of the total people that work, 9 worked from home and 105 commuted. The average number of hours worked is 37.8.
